The childhood of a young Roma boy reaches a sudden and drastic end when he loses his family in a tragic and brutal attack. A young lawyer gives in to the pressure from her superior and undertakes the defence of one of the men facing trial for the part he reputedly played in this infamous series of racist murders. A mysterious teenage girl becomes involved when her boyfriend’s dark secrets come to light. With strong biblical roots, the story is told via the journeys of very different individuals from completely separate sections of society whose paths never cross but whose fates become entwined as they twist through the shadow cast by a horrendous crime. The feature film GENESIS, inspired by a true story, is a dramatic depiction of sin, catharsis and rebirth.

 

 

Árpád Bogdán born in 1980, lived in a children’s home from the age of four. He organized creative forums for disadvantaged children using various aspects of art. His directorial debut, HAPPY NEW LIFE, premiered at Biennale 2007, was internationally acclaimed and awarded with the Manfred Salzgeber Award – Special Mention. His latest feature length fiction, GENESIS, premiered at Berlinale in 2018 and won a number of awards. He is currently developing two further feature films: THE NECROMANCER and IKAROS.
